My first coffee table was a wooden crate I found behind a grocery store. It held my laptop, my dinner plates, and eventually a ring of water stains that became part of the finish. A coffee table does not need to be fancy. It needs to be the right height for your feet and sturdy enough for someone to put their drink down without looking.
The right coffee table balances form and function while fitting your room’s size and layout. Coffee tables come in many shapes, sizes, and materials, from glass and wood to metal and stone. Some feature storage compartments, drawers, or shelves underneath. Others focus purely on design with clean lines and simple surfaces.
Size and height are the most important factors to consider when shopping for a coffee table. The table should be about two-thirds the length of your sofa and sit roughly the same height as your couch cushions. You also need to leave enough space around the table for people to walk comfortably. Buying Guide
When we shop for a coffee table, we need to think about several key factors. The right choice depends on our specific needs and space.
Size and Space
We should measure our seating area first. The table should be about 16-18 inches from our couch or chairs.
A good rule is to pick a table that’s two-thirds the length of our sofa. The height should match our seat cushions or be slightly lower.
Materials and Durability
| Material |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|
| Wood | Strong, classic look | Can scratch easily |
| Glass | Easy to clean, modern | Shows fingerprints |
| Metal | Very durable | Can be cold feeling |
| Stone | Long-lasting | Heavy, expensive |
Storage Options
We might want a table with built-in storage. Drawers or shelves help keep our living room tidy.
Some tables have lift-up tops that reveal hidden compartments. This feature works well for small spaces.
Style and Design
The table should match our existing furniture. We can choose between modern, traditional, or rustic styles.
Round tables work better in tight spaces. Square or rectangular tables offer more surface area.
